The boat races across the water, the motor buzzing relentlessly. The nose bounces up and down across the heaving waves, forcing the passengers to cling onto the metal rails for dear life. But they love it. Sunshine splashes on the pristine blue of the water and everything is right in the world.
The rushing wind throws the passengers' hair out of control and whips sweet sea spray into their faces. Later, they might complain about the sticky white salt that still clings to their skin. But right now, they scream with approval and their brains scream with delight.
